Understanding Sweet and Sour Dry Chicken: Sweet and sour dry chicken is a beloved dish that originated in Chinese cuisine, now cherished worldwide. It features succulent chicken pieces marinated, stir-fried, and coated in a sticky sweet and tangy sauce. While traditional versions are served with ample sauce, the dry rendition focuses on a crispy coating enveloping each chicken morsel, offering a delightful texture and intense flavor.
Ingredients for Sweet and Sour Dry Chicken:
- 500 grams boneless, skinless chicken breast or thighs, diced
- 2 tablespoons soy sauce
- 1 tablespoon rice vinegar
- 1 tablespoon honey or brown sugar
- 1 tablespoon cornstarch
- 1 tablespoon vegetable oil
- 1 onion, thinly sliced
- 1 bell pepper, thinly sliced
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1-inch piece of ginger, grated
- 1 tablespoon tomato ketchup
- 1 tablespoon chili sauce (to taste)
- Salt and pepper, to taste
- Chopped spring onions, for garnish
- Sesame seeds, for garnish
Instructions:
Marinate the Chicken: In a bowl, combine soy sauce, rice vinegar, honey or brown sugar, and cornstarch. Add chicken pieces, ensuring they are coated evenly. Marinate for at least 30 minutes in the refrigerator.
Stir-Fry the Chicken: Heat vegetable oil in a skillet over medium-high heat. Stir-fry chicken until golden and cooked through, about 5-7 minutes. Remove chicken and set aside.
Prepare the Sauce: In the same skillet, sauté onion, bell pepper, garlic, and ginger until tender-crisp.
Enhance with Sauces: Add tomato ketchup and chili sauce, adjusting to taste. Season with salt and pepper.
Combine Chicken and Sauce: Return chicken to the skillet. Toss to coat evenly with sauce and vegetables. Cook until heated through and well combined.
Garnish and Serve: Transfer sweet and sour dry chicken to a serving platter. Garnish with spring onions and sesame seeds.
Enjoy: Serve hot with rice or noodles for a satisfying meal.
Variations and Tips:
- For added complexity, include pineapple chunks or canned pineapple tidbits.
- Experiment with vegetables like carrots, snow peas, or broccoli.
- Adjust sweetness and tanginess by altering honey, rice vinegar, and tomato ketchup ratios.
- Increase heat with additional chili sauce or fresh chili peppers.
